#5bbc59 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5bbc59 is composed of 35.7% red, 73.7% green and 34.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 52.7%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 118.8 degrees, a saturation of 42.5% and a lightness of 54.3%. #5bbc59 color hex could be obtained by blending #b6ffb2 with #007900.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

#5bbc59 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5bbc59 has RGB values of R:91, G:188, B:89 and CMYK values of C:0.52, M:0, Y:0.53,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 6011993.

Shades and Tints of #5bbc59
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010201 is the darkest color, while #f3faf3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#5bbc59
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#868f86 is the less saturated color, while #1ffb1a is the most saturated one.
